Popular summaries
Sign in
Get started today
  1. Home
  2. My videos
  3. How To Build Product As A Small Startup - Michael Seibel

Summary

Having a clear process for product release is crucial for small startups, as it helps avoid debates, missed deadlines, and discouragement. Startups should decide on a release schedule based on factors like the product development cycle and approval processes. Putting someone in charge of product ensures goals are met and the product is successfully launched. Establishing Key Performance Indicators (KPIs) such as new content created, new users, and retained users is essential for measuring success. Creating a theme for the product cycle based on a KPI helps prioritize decision-making. The product meeting is the only formal meeting held by the team and aims to reach conclusions on what features to build. Brainstorming new features, bugs, and tests is important, with ideas categorized and sorted based on feasibility. Prioritizing hard tasks first helps identify easier ones and create a list for efficient progress. Specifying ideas and assigning tasks is crucial, and the team should shut up and get to work, focusing on getting the product out and learning from customer feedback. Thorough testing involving the entire team is recommended, with a set cadence and comprehensive checklist.

Have a process to get product out the door

  • Importance of having a process to get a product out the door in a small startup
  • Personal experience of facing problems due to lack of clear process
  • Debates, missed deadlines, and discouragement as consequences
  • Emphasis on need for startups to have a formal process for efficient product release

Decide on a release schedule

  • Factors to consider when deciding on a release schedule for a small startup include the product development cycle and approval processes.
  • An example of a release schedule is releasing an iOS app every two weeks, which aligns with the time required for Apple's approval.

Put someone in charge of product

  • Putting someone in charge of product in a small startup means ensuring the goals of the development cycle are met and the product is successfully launched.
  • This role does not involve making decisions about what to build.

Establish KPIs

Establishing Key Performance Indicators (KPIs) is crucial for small startups. The three KPIs mentioned are new content created, new users, and retained users.

  • KPIs are essential for measuring the success and progress of a startup.
  • New content created is a valuable KPI as it indicates the company's ability to generate fresh and engaging material.
  • Acquiring new users is another important KPI as it demonstrates the startup's ability to attract and engage a wider audience.
  • Retained users are a key KPI as they indicate the startup's ability to retain and satisfy its existing user base.

Create a theme for the product cycle based on a KPI

  • Creating a theme for the product development cycle based on a KPI involves focusing on a specific metric, such as user retention.
  • The goal is to align the entire company's efforts towards improving that KPI.
  • This approach helps prioritize and guide decision-making throughout the product development cycle.

Product meeting

The product meeting is the key aspect of the process of product development in a small startup. It is the only formal meeting held by the team and aims to reach conclusions on what features to build for the product. The meeting starts with a brainstorming session and utilizes a whiteboard with three different categories for new features.

  • The product meeting is the only formal meeting held by the team
  • It aims to reach conclusions on what features to build for the product
  • The meeting starts with a brainstorming session
  • A whiteboard with three different categories is used for new features

Brainstorm new features, bugs, and tests

The video discusses the process of brainstorming new features, bugs, and tests for a small startup.

Key points:

  • Participants were encouraged to share ideas to improve KPIs and user retention.
  • Ideas were written on a board without debate or criticism.
  • Ideas were categorized into new features, iterations of existing features, bugs, or tests.
  • Bugs were given special attention as they can hinder growth and user retention.
  • The team had a list of potential features and actions for product development.

Sort each into: easy, medium, or hard

  • The process of "easy medium hard" helps small startup teams prioritize ideas for development
  • Ideas are graded based on the time it would take to build them, ranging from a couple of hours to multiple days
  • This framework ensures inclusivity in decision-making, considers other people's ideas, and prioritizes ideas based on feasibility and speed of implementation.

Pick the hards first

  • Prioritize the hardest tasks first in a small startup
  • Hard tasks require more time and effort
  • Focusing on hard tasks helps identify easier ones and eliminate less effective ideas
  • Create a list of hard, medium, and easy tasks for efficient progress

Spec the ideas out and assign tasks

  • Specifying ideas and assigning tasks is crucial for building a product as a small startup.
  • This involves writing a detailed description of what needs to be built and assigning responsibilities to team members.
  • The specification should be documented in a product management system to ensure everyone is on the same page and working towards the same goal.

Shut up and get to work

  • The importance of shutting up and getting to work in product development
  • Not dwelling on ideas that were not chosen
  • Focusing on the upcoming development cycle
  • Getting the product out to customers and learning from their feedback
  • Having confidence that future cycles will yield better results

Testing

Testing is a crucial aspect of product development for small startups. To ensure thorough testing, the entire team should be involved, including engineers and other employees. Creating a testing cycle with a set cadence and a comprehensive checklist can help streamline the process and facilitate bug fixing. This approach proved successful for the speaker's company and is recommended for other startups.

Have questions about the video? Create a FREE account to ask Wiz AI
Sign up
7 days free trial

Copyright © 2024 Video Wiz. All rights reserved.